PAXTON - Matthew “Matt” M. Larson, age 45, passed away suddenly on Wednesday, July 1, 2020 at UMass Medical Center in Worcester after a brief illness. Born in Worcester, Matt was the son of Chester and Cheryl Ann (Dutil) Rossier.
Matt spent his youth in Paxton, graduating from Wachusett Regional High School in 1992. He followed his passion of cooking and went on to work as a chef for many places throughout his life, most notably at Tatnuck Book Seller in Worcester and later at EMC in Hopkinton. On an ideal day, Matt could be found casting his fishing pole into the Quabbin Reservoir with his good friend John Derr. Matt was nothing short of being an entertainer. He always had something to say and will be remembered for his wit and sarcasm.
Matt is survived by his parents Chester D. Rossier and his wife, Cheryl of Paxton; and two sisters, Elizabeth M. Rossier of Paxton, Amy C. Tarquinio and her husband, Jeffrey of New Braintree.
